recipes-core/easysplash: Fix OE-Core compatibility and runtime dependencies#116
Open
lucianogdittgen wants to merge 3 commits into
Open
recipes-core/easysplash: Fix OE-Core compatibility and runtime dependencies#116lucianogdittgen wants to merge 3 commits into
lucianogdittgen wants to merge 3 commits into
Conversation
…stallation easysplash-common-2.0.inc: Drop the redundant 'S' assignment, as it defaults to /git for git-based recipes. easysplash-config_2.0.0.bb: Use for the configuration file source to comply with the recent OE-Core 'unpack-to-unpackdir' changes. easysplash_2.0.0.bb: Explicitly pass 'INIT' and 'SYSTEMD' flags to 'oe_runmake' during the service installation in 'do_install:append'. This ensures the build system correctly identifies which service files to install based on the enabled PACKAGECONFIG, while removing these flags from the default PACKAGECONFIG variables where they were not effectively reaching the install target.
Enable the kms PACKAGECONFIG so the gstreamer1.0-plugins-bad-kms package is built from the layer metadata. EasySplash animation recipes depend on this runtime package, so keeping the setting in the layer avoids requiring a local.conf workaround and fixes the build-deps QA issue.
Member
|
Send this to the master first, and then we do the backport afterwards. |
Update the EasySplash recipes to satisfy oelint checks by adding missing metadata, fixing SPDX license syntax, avoiding duplicate license assignments, and using the expected BitBake append spacing. Rename the EasySplash animation class to use an underscore and update the animation recipes to inherit the new class name.
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Update the EasySplash recipes for recent OE-Core behavior and clean up the metadata expected by oelint.
This change:
${UNPACKDIR}for installed configuration sources.INITandSYSTEMDexplicitly when installing service files.